An Unknown Country is a novel written by Dinah Maria Mulock Craik and published in 1887. The story revolves around the life of a young woman named Hester Kirton, who is forced to leave her home in England and travel to an unknown country in order to start a new life. Hester's journey is fraught with danger and uncertainty, as she struggles to adapt to her new surroundings and forge a new identity for herself. Along the way, she encounters a variety of colorful characters, including a mysterious stranger who seems to know more about her past than he lets on. As Hester navigates the challenges of her new life, she must confront her own fears and insecurities, and ultimately find the strength to build a new future for herself in this unknown country.
